• Jc and grain boundary property of BaFe2(As,P)2 thin films were investigated.
• We found a correlation of Jc with the Fe/Ba composition ratio.
• A very large Jc of 1.2 × 107 A/cm2 was observed with a Fe rich thin film.
• A grain boundary junction having a misorientation angle of 24° was fabricated.
• Jc across the grain boundary (θGB = 24°) recorded 106 A/cm2.
We have investigated the critical current density (Jc) and the grain boundary property of BaFe2(As,P)2 thin films grown on MgO single crystal or bicrystal substrates by molecular beam epitaxy. We found a strong correlation between Jc and the Fe/Ba composition ratio, and a very large self-field Jc of 1.2 × 107 A/cm2 at 4.2 K with a thin film for which the Fe/Ba ratio was 2.4. A grain boundary junction was fabricated by growing a thin film on a MgO bicrystal substrate having a misorientation angle of 24°. The inter-grain Jc at 4.0 K recorded 106 A/cm2, which is higher than that of YBa2Cu3Oy. These results demonstrate the high potential of BaFe2(As,P)2 in practical applications and indicate that the necessary condition for in-plane alignment is less severe than YBa2Cu3Oy.
